Abstract

The invention relates to the field of body-in-white conveying equipment, and provides a safety braking mechanism. The safety braking mechanism comprises a braking wheel, a mounting base and two braking units symmetrically arranged on the two sides of the middle line of the mounting base. The braking wheel and the mounting base are mounted on an upper frame body of the conveying equipment. Bosses are arranged at the two ends of the mounting base correspondingly. Each braking unit comprises an air cylinder, a connecting plate and a braking pin. The two ends of a cylinder body of each air cylinder are fixed to the bosses at the two ends of the mounting base correspondingly, and a piston rod of each air cylinder is connected with one end of the corresponding connecting plate. The end, connected with the corresponding piston rod, of the tail of each connecting plate is connected with one end of the corresponding braking pin. Each braking pin penetrates the bosses at the two ends of the mounting base and is parallel to the corresponding air cylinder, and the length of each braking pin is larger than that of the mounting base. Arc-shaped holes used for being matched with the braking pins are evenly distributed in the braking wheel in the circumferential direction. According to the safety braking mechanism, the equipment can be stopped working during power interruption and air interruption, and the safety of the equipment during operating and maintaining is improved.

technical field [0001] The invention relates to the field of body-in-white conveying equipment, in particular to a safety braking mechanism. Background technique [0002] In the body-in-white conveying equipment of the production line, the upper frame lifts the body-in-white through motors, belts, etc., so that the equipment rises to the right position, and the conveying equipment moves horizontally to the next station. During the transportation process, if the equipment is abnormal, there may be sudden gas failure, power failure or sudden fall of the lower frame, etc. At this time, it is necessary to brake the equipment to prevent production safety problems. In addition, during equipment maintenance, if the equipment does not stop accurately, it may cause injury to workers.
